Subject: Fillwise cut-over complete

Hi all,

The Fillwise restock planner moved to the new scheduling backend last night. Plugin hooks fire identically, but route suggestions now arrive in a single batch at 05:00. No plugin code changes are required. For reference, the planner now runs with the following configuration values.

config for yajep-tafof:
[rusath]
team = julmir
access_code = ac_fe37fd
host = rusath.novactech.test
port = 8000
owner = pelmir.weneth
peer = oliwyn.olvarqdyn.internal

# QuillSearch Environments

QuillSearch autocomplete runs in three environments: dev, staging, prod. The slow-index issue is confined to prod; dev and staging use the smaller Larkfield corpus and won't reproduce it. Index rebuilds are nightly. Access is restricted to the indexer role; no external ingress. Staging mirrors prod topology at quarter scale. For the security review, the prod configuration in effect during the slow-index incident is listed below:

deployment values, kajep-kageg:
[praix]
host = praix.paliqcorp.corp
user = praix_svc
database = praix_prod

## 2.4.0 — Hermetic build migration (Forgebox)

Breaking: the Brindlecraft build now runs under Forgebox sandboxing. Network access during builds is gone; all deps come from the internal mirror. Renamed BRINDLE_BUILD_KEY to FORGEBOX_MIRROR_TOKEN — the old name is ignored as of this release. Update your local .env accordingly. The mirror rejects unauthenticated pulls, so before your first build, add this line:

secret setting of bagag-fafof: LEDGER_TOKEN29=2087e95a7be258fc3f2cc54ea20c7

## Trace Propagation: Verification Steps

When reviewing changes to the Lattice Relay tracing middleware, confirm that the span context header is forwarded on every outbound call, including retries. Missing propagation in the Orchard billing service caused orphaned traces last quarter, so check the interceptor ordering carefully. To reproduce locally, run the trace-echo harness against staging and verify span parentage in Glimmerboard. The harness authenticates against the collector using the key below.

gateway credential: kto3_qfe